NATIONAL AWARD TO TEACHERS

The National Teacher Award is given every year to selected teachers on the basis of the standards set by the Ministry of Human Resource Development, Government of India. Teachers make their online application for this award, after which the list of teachers meeting the standards is checked by the District Level Screening Committee and sent to the state along with the attached application. After that, the State Level Screening Committee, vetted and graded these teachers on the basis of excellence in their work and service. Keeping in mind the excellence, maximum three teachers are nominated finaly for this award by the member committee of the director under the chairmanship of the secretary. The nominated teachers are re-screened by the Ministry of Human Resource Development, Government of India and selected for the said award. The selected teacher is honored by the President of India. For National Teacher Award-2019, two teachers of the state Mrs. Nirupama Kumari, Assistant Teacher, Ramrudra +2 High School, Chas, Bokaro and Mr. Smith Kumar Soni, Assistant Teacher, Ra. Middle School, Bano, Simdega got selected. For the National Teacher Award-2020, Shri Manoj Kumar Singh, Assistant Teacher, Hindustan Mitra Mandal Vidyalaya, Jamshedpur, East Singhbhum has been selected. Link of National Award to Teachers:

NATIONAL ICT AWARD :- National ICT Award is given by NCERT to such teachers who have successfully used modern techniques in teaching-learning processes. To apply this award, teachers send online applications to NCERT. As a nodal agency JCERT Reviews the profile and work of applicant teachers and as far as possible sends three names to NCERT for final selection.

For the year 2019, the following two teachers of our state have received the National ICT Award -

  1. Mrs. Shweta Sharma, Vivekananda Middle School, Deoghar
  2. Smt. Nirupama Kumari, Ramrudra +2 High School, Chas, Bokaro
